首页
外语
计算机
考研
公务员
职业资格
财经
工程
司法
医学
专升本
自考
实用职业技能
登录
计算机
某系统中有四种互斥资源R1、R2、R3和R4,可用资源数分别为3、5、6和8。假设在T0时刻有P1、P2、P3和P4四个进程,并且这些进程对资源的最大需求量和已分配资源数如下表所示,那么在T0时刻系统中R1、R2、R3和R4的剩余资源数分别为(22)。如果
某系统中有四种互斥资源R1、R2、R3和R4,可用资源数分别为3、5、6和8。假设在T0时刻有P1、P2、P3和P4四个进程,并且这些进程对资源的最大需求量和已分配资源数如下表所示,那么在T0时刻系统中R1、R2、R3和R4的剩余资源数分别为(22)。如果
admin
2008-11-02
52
问题
某系统中有四种互斥资源R1、R2、R3和R4,可用资源数分别为3、5、6和8。假设在T0时刻有P1、P2、P3和P4四个进程,并且这些进程对资源的最大需求量和已分配资源数如下表所示,那么在T0时刻系统中R1、R2、R3和R4的剩余资源数分别为(22)。如果从T0时刻开始进程按(23)顺序逐个调度执行,那么系统状态是安全的。
选项
A、P1→P2→P4→P3
B、P2→P1→P4→P3
C、P3→P2→P1→P4
D、P4→P2→P3→P1
答案
C
解析
本题考查操作系统进程管理中死锁检测的多项资源银行家算法。
由于T0时刻已用资源数为3、4、6和7,故剩余资源数为0、1、0和1,各进程尚需资源数为可列表如下。
P1、P2、P3和P4这4个进程中,系统只能满足P3的尚需资源数(0,1,0,1),因为此时系统可用资源数为(0,1,0,1),能满足P3的需求保证P3能运行完,写上完成标志true,如下表所示。P3释放资源后系统的可用资源为(1,2,1,1),此时P2尚需资源(1,0,0,0),系统能满足P2的请求,故P2能运行完,写上完成标志true。 P2释放资源后系统的可用资源为(1,3,3,3),此时尸1尚需资源(0,1,1,2),P4尚需资源(0,0,1,2),系统能满足P1和P4的请求,故P1和P4能运行完,写上完成标志true。进程可按P3→P2→P1→P4或者P3→P2→P4→P1的顺序执行,每个进程都可以获得需要的资源运行完毕,写上完成标记,所以系统的状态是安全的。
根据试题的可选答案,正确的答案应为C。
转载请注明原文地址:https://kaotiyun.com/show/BcUZ777K
本试题收录于:
数据库系统工程师上午基础知识考试题库软考中级分类
0
数据库系统工程师上午基础知识考试
软考中级
相关试题推荐
因承建单位违反合同导致工程竣工时间延迟,监理单位(63)。关于信息工程实施合同中关于工期的叙述,不正确的是(64)。
(14)可以帮助人们简单方便地复用已经成功的设计或体系结构。
根据《软件生存周期过程GB/T 8566-2001》,开发过程的第一活动是(11)。
某工程包括A,B,C,D,E,F,G7个作业,各个作业的紧前作业、所需时间、所需人数如下表所示。 该工程的计算工期为(66)周。按此工期,整个工程至少需要(67)人。
在大型项目或多项目实施的过程中,负责实施的项目经理对这些项目大都采用(57)的方式。投资大、建设周期长、专业复杂的大型项目最好采用(58)的组织形式或近似的组织形式。
在管理信息系统项目的实施过程中,不仅需要管理过程,也需要技术过程、支持过程、过程改进和商务过程等,它们分别来自项目管理知识、项目环境知识、通用的管理知识和技能、软技能或人际关系技能以及(41)。
RUP是信息系统项目的生命周期模型之一,“确保软件结构、需求、计划足够稳定;确保项目风险已经降低到能够预计完成整个项目的成本和日程的程度。针对项目的软件结构上的主要风险已经解决或处理完成”是该模型(25)阶段的主要任务。
为了使构件系统更切合实际、更有效地被复用,构件应当具备(15),以提高其通用性。
招标公告应当载明招标人的名称和地址、招标项目的(6)、数量、实施地点和时间,以及获取招标文件的办法等事项。
随机试题
临床上对伴有细胞外液减少的低钠血症一般首先应用
从下列五个选项中选择正确答案:A.膝关节肿胀,剧烈疼痛,高热,X线片示关节承重面骨质明显破坏,关节肿胀 B.膝关节肿胀,疼痛,X线片示膝关节非承重面骨质破坏,关节肿胀C.膝关节肿胀,疼痛,X线片示膝关节面边缘虫噬样骨质破坏,伴有多关节病变
关于古琴,下列说法不正确的是()。
抽油机按照结构和工作原理不同可分为游梁式抽油机和()抽油机。
specialdrawingright________
在德育过程中,起主导作用的因素是
中和抗体抗病毒的机制是
下列应按增值税小规模纳税人的标准缴纳增值税的有()。
当整个社会都______着书香的时候,当爱读书、读好书成为人们不变的______的时候,这样的社会和这样的人们必定是健康而富足的。填入划横线部分最恰当的一项是:
求函数y=ln(x+)的反函数.
最新回复
(
0
)